diff --git a/src/resources/extensions/gsd/json-persistence.ts b/src/resources/extensions/gsd/json-persistence.ts index c58c28cf1..8c6c2776c 100644 --- a/src/resources/extensions/gsd/json-persistence.ts +++ b/src/resources/extensions/gsd/json-persistence.ts @@ -39,13 +39,21 @@ export function loadJsonFileOrNull( } /** - * Save a JSON file, creating parent directories as needed. + * Save a JSON file atomically (write to .tmp, then rename). + * Creates parent directories as needed. * Non-fatal — swallows errors to prevent persistence from breaking operations. + * + * Uses atomic write-tmp-rename to prevent partial/corrupt files on crash. + * This is the canonical way to persist JSON state in GSD — all callers + * (queue-order, metrics, routing-history, reactive-graph) benefit from + * crash-safety without code changes. */ export function saveJsonFile(filePath: string, data: T): void { try { mkdirSync(dirname(filePath), { recursive: true }); - writeFileSync(filePath, JSON.stringify(data, null, 2) + "\n", "utf-8"); + const tmp = filePath + ".tmp"; + writeFileSync(tmp, JSON.stringify(data, null, 2) + "\n", "utf-8"); + renameSync(tmp, filePath); } catch { // Non-fatal — don't let persistence failures break operation } diff --git a/src/resources/extensions/gsd/tests/json-persistence-atomic.test.ts b/src/resources/extensions/gsd/tests/json-persistence-atomic.test.ts new file mode 100644 index 000000000..39bb169a9 --- /dev/null +++ b/src/resources/extensions/gsd/tests/json-persistence-atomic.test.ts @@ -0,0 +1,183 @@ +/** + * json-persistence-atomic.test.ts — Tests for atomic JSON persistence. + * + * Verifies that saveJsonFile() uses atomic write-tmp-rename pattern + * so that crashes mid-write don't corrupt the target file. + */ + +import test from "node:test";
